All-Day Brunch Restaurant Ruby Sunshine Coming to Downtown Charleston

All-day brunch restaurant Ruby Sunshine today announced plans to open a location later this year in Downtown Charleston. The restaurant will be located at 171 E Bay Street, which is the former home of Blossom.

Ruby Sunshine says they will offer New Orleans-inspired twists on traditional Southern brunch favorites, including Eggs Benedicts, Beignets, Bananas Foster Pain Perdu and seasonally stuffed French Toast, as well as cocktails. You can see a sample menu here.

Ruby Sunshine is owned and operated through the Ruby Slipper Restaurant Group, the collective behind the acclaimed New Orleans-based eatery Ruby Slipper Café. Their expansion into the Holy City is part of its growth across the Southeast region, which includes locations in Alabama, Tennessee, and North Carolina.

“We’re excited to bring our Big Easy-inspired brunch to the Lowcountry,” said Peter Gaudreau, CEO of Ruby Slipper Restaurant Group. “Charleston is a natural next step for our expansion, and we think the city captures that sense of New Orleans hospitality and southern charm that Ruby Sunshine is all about.”

The restaurant will feature indoor seating for approximately 170 guests, in addition to an outdoor enclosed patio area for about 30 guests. In addition to welcoming  guests, Ruby Sunshine will offer job opportunities for locals. Job openings will be listed on the Ruby Sunshine website soon.

Husband-and-wife team, Jennifer and Erich Weishaupt opened the original Ruby Slipper Café to draw people back to their Mid-City New Orleans neighborhood after Hurricane Katrina. The Ruby Slipper Restaurant Group has since grown to operate 11 Ruby Slipper Café locations across the Gulf Region and continue to expand throughout the Southeast with Ruby Sunshine. The Downtown Charleston restaurant will mark the first South Carolina restaurant and ninth Ruby Sunshine location.

To learn more about the restaurant, visit www.rubysunshine.com. No opening date has been announced yet.
